Milwaukee-based Irgens Partners LLC plans to transform a 13.9-acre office building site in the Milwaukee County Research Park into a mix of uses.

The redevelopment effort will involve renovating an existing 130,000-square-foot office building at 10701 Research Drive. Next steps include construction of a new 43,000-square-foot medical office building along North Mayfair Road, an 8,000-square-foot retail building southeast of Research Drive and Mayfair and 185 new apartment units northeast of East Wisconsin Avenue and Mayfair.

Irgens revealed details of its mixed-use project in December after buying the site in August for $9.5 million and advancing plans in November to divide the property into smaller lots.

Owner: 10701 Research Drive Development Partners LLC, an Irgens affiliate Size: 13.9 acres Buildings: Five
